Set in the renowned Exmoor National Park with an impressive panorama of the sea, the location of this peaceful shepherd’s hut is hard to beat. Explore this unique coastline by day, before relaxing in your private Bohemian hot tub during starry nights. The picturesque towns of Lynton and Lynmouth (1.5 miles) offer a wide selection of cafes and restaurants, with everything from tapas to Thai. Fish and chips by the harbour is a must. Hop aboard the cliff railway or Woody Bay Station for impressive views by train. One of the most remarkable local landmarks has to be the Valley of the Rocks, a unique geological formation accessed with a walk along the South West Coast Path. Visit Watersmeet, Brendon Valley (both within 3 miles), or venture 9 miles down the coast to Porlock.

This coastal getaway is perfect for a peaceful break surrounded by nature on the Exmoor coast. Stepping through the large patio doors, you will immediately find a practical kitchen, which has everything you need for cooking during your break. The cosy wood burner ensures you can enjoy a warm, cosy interior on cooler nights. The other end of the hut has a seating area with dining table and a pull down double bed over - ensuring a comfortable nights sleep. Overhead is a skylight window that provides an ideal opportunity for stargazing in this fantastic Dark Sky Reserve setting. An ensuite shower/WC completes this unique accommodation.

Outside, you will find your own lovely enclosed garden, a lovely dog-friendly space, which provides a lawn, grassy banks, hedges, and several spaces to sit, eat, drink, and simply enjoy the fresh air. Relax in the Scandi-style, luxury hot tub or sizzle up something special on the BBQ. Off-road parking is provided for one car.
